Retrojam 2, released in 2024, is an expansion offering substantial new content for a classic shooter framework. The core gameplay involves navigating and engaging in combat across 19 newly crafted maps, all accessible via a central hub area. Its primary appeal is the addition of extensive, original environments and challenges built upon established mechanics, providing fresh exploration for returning players.
